首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Spring Cloud与Spring AMQP签约

Spring Cloud是一个基于Spring Framework的开源框架,用于构建分布式系统的微服务架构。它提供了一系列的工具和组件,用于快速开发和部署云原生应用程序。

Spring AMQP是Spring Framework的一个子项目,用于构建基于AMQP(高级消息队列协议)的应用程序。它提供了一套简单易用的API,用于发送和接收消息,并支持可靠的消息传递。

Spring Cloud与Spring AMQP的签约是指它们之间的集成和协作。通过将Spring Cloud和Spring AMQP结合使用,可以实现在分布式系统中使用消息队列进行异步通信和解耦,从而提高系统的可伸缩性和可靠性。

Spring Cloud提供了对消息队列的抽象和封装,使开发人员可以轻松地使用Spring AMQP进行消息的发送和接收。它还提供了一些额外的功能,如服务注册与发现、负载均衡、断路器等,以帮助开发人员构建弹性和可靠的分布式系统。

Spring Cloud与Spring AMQP的签约在以下场景中非常有用:

  1. 微服务架构:通过使用消息队列进行服务之间的异步通信,可以实现松耦合的微服务架构。
  2. 异步处理:将耗时的任务放入消息队列中,可以实现异步处理,提高系统的响应速度和吞吐量。
  3. 事件驱动架构:通过使用消息队列传递事件,可以实现事件驱动的架构,使系统更加灵活和可扩展。
  4. 分布式事务:通过使用消息队列进行分布式事务的协调,可以确保跨多个服务的操作的一致性。

腾讯云提供了一系列与Spring Cloud和Spring AMQP相关的产品和服务,包括:

  1. 云消息队列CMQ:提供高可靠、高可用的消息队列服务,可与Spring AMQP集成使用。 产品介绍链接:https://cloud.tencent.com/product/cmq
  2. 云原生应用引擎TKE:提供容器化的应用程序管理平台,可用于部署和管理基于Spring Cloud的微服务应用程序。 产品介绍链接:https://cloud.tencent.com/product/tke
  3. 云函数SCF:提供无服务器的函数计算服务,可用于处理异步任务和事件驱动的业务逻辑。 产品介绍链接:https://cloud.tencent.com/product/scf

通过使用腾讯云的这些产品和服务,开发人员可以更加方便地构建和部署基于Spring Cloud和Spring AMQP的分布式系统,并获得高可靠性和可扩展性的优势。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Spring Cloud|03 Spring CloudDubbo

几点说明 1、本系列Spring Cloud的博客参考了方志朋所著《深入理解Spring Cloud微服务构建》; 2、大家如果想更加深入的理解Spring Cloud 建议多实战、多看书; Dubbo...; 升级性:服务器集群升级,不会对现有架构造成压力; Spring Cloud Dubbo 服务关注点 Spring Cloud Dubbo 配置管理 config 无 服务发现 Eureka、Consul...RPC、NIO 安全模块 Spring Cloud Security 无 其他方面: 更新频率 Spring Cloud保持着十分高频率的更新,并且社区活跃度也很高,这对于一个架构来说是一件十分利好的事情...,至少Spring Cloud是在飞速发展的; 而Dubbo自从2013年3月开始暂停了更新,接下来的五年时间里都没有进行技术上的更新迭代,直到2017年9月才重新更新; 开发风格 Spring Cloud...更趋向使用注解+JavaBean的配置方式的敏捷开发; Dubbo则趋向于使用Spring XML的配置方式; 通信方式 Spring Cloud大多数使用的是基于HTTP Restful的风格,服务服务之间完全无关

66830

Spring Cloud BusSpring Cloud Stream的关系

概述Spring Cloud Bus 和 Spring Cloud Stream 是两个非常实用的分布式系统组件,它们都是 Spring Cloud 生态系统中的一部分,可以用来传递事件、消息、配置等信息...本文将介绍 Spring Cloud Bus 和 Spring Cloud Stream 的关系,并提供一个示例来说明它们的用法。...Spring Cloud Bus 和 Spring Cloud Stream 的关系Spring Cloud Bus 和 Spring Cloud Stream 都是用于消息传递和事件通知的分布式系统组件...具体来说,Spring Cloud Bus 可以作为 Spring Cloud Stream 的一种实现方式,通过 Spring Cloud Bus 实现消息传递和事件通知。...例如,可以在 Spring Cloud Stream 中使用 Spring Cloud Bus 发布/订阅事件,以便在不同的服务之间共享事件信息。

86920

Spring -> Spring Boot > Spring Cloud

这几天刚刚上班,公司用的是Spring Cloud,接触不多。我得赶快学起来。 想学习就必须得知道什么是微服务,什么是Spring Boot,什么是Spring Cloud,以及两者之间有什么关系?...SOA – 两者都是架构风格范畴,但其关注领域涉及范围不同。SOA更关注企业规模范围,微服务架构则更关注应用规模范围。 微服务组件 vs....因此应该比较的是微服务架构SOA。 微服务 vs. API – 不恰当的比较。 API是接口,是业务功能暴露的一种机制。微服务架构是用于实施业务功能的组件架构。因此直接比较它们是没有意义的。...,Spring Cloud是一个基于Spring Boot实现的云应用开发工具;Spring Boot专注于快速、方便集成的单个微服务个体,Spring Cloud关注全局的服务治理框架;Spring...Spring Boot可以离开Spring Cloud独立使用开发项目,但是Spring Cloud离不开Spring Boot,属于依赖的关系。

2.9K32

Spring Cloud|02 Spring Cloud简介

几点说明 1、本系列Spring Cloud的博客参考了方志朋所著《深入理解Spring Cloud微服务构建》; 2、大家如果想更加深入的理解Spring Cloud 建议多实战、多看书; 简介...Spring Cloud Security Spring Cloud Security 是对Spring Security的封装,向服务提供用户验证的权限认证,一般来说它会配合Spring Security...Spring Cloud Sleuth Spring Cloud Sleuth是一个分布式的链路跟踪组件,它封装了Dapper、Zipkin和Kibana等组件,通过它可以知道服务服务之间的依赖关系,...便于后期维护管理。...Spring Cloud Task Spring Cloud Task基于Spring Task,主要用于提供任务调度以及任务管理等方面的功能,在分布式事务中会用到。

77820

Spring Cloud Docker 实战

类别 知识 微服务开发框架 SpringCloud 1.单体应用和微服务架构应用的区别 2.微服务架构的技术选型 开始使用 Spring Cloud 实战微服务 1.分布式系统的大致组成...2.服务提供者和消费者的关系 3.通过Maven引用SpringCloud依赖 4.通过SpringCloud编写微服务 整合 Spring Boot Actuator 1.指标监控是什么?...2.为微服务集成SpringBootActuator 3.基础指标监控的端点 微服务注册发现 1.服务注册/发现中心的作用 2.什么是服务提供者 3.什么事服务消费者 4.EurekaServer...Hystrix 容错处理 1.实现容错的常见三种机制 2.在项目中如何使用Hystrix Zuul 网关 1.网关的作用以及什么是网关 2.SpringCloudZuul介绍 3.Zuul的使用 Spring...Cloud Config 配置管理 1.配置中心的作用 2.SpringCloudConfig简介 3.SpringCloudConfig使用 Sleuth Zipkin 结合图形化展示 1

38920

spring cloud

耦合:两个服务的关联度,完全耦合,松耦合,完全解耦 Springboot:springBoot是一个框架,一种全新的编程规范,它的产生简化了框架的使用,所谓简化是指简化了spring众多框架中所需的大量且繁琐的配置文件...Springcloud:sprin cloud基于springboot提供了一整套微服务的解决方案,包括服务注册发现,配置中心,全链路监控,服务网关,负载均衡,熔断器等组件。...减少了客户端各个微服务之间的交互次数。 Spring cloud bus(统一配置服务):对于服务的单体应用,常使用配置文件管理所有配置。...如果需要切换环境,可设置多个profile,并在启动应用时指定spring.profiles.active=[profile]。然而,在微服务架构中,微服务的配置管理一般有以下需求: 集中管理配置。...Spring cloud bus 利用git或svn等管理配置,采用kafka或者rabbitMQ等消息总线通知所有应用,从而实现配置的自动更新并且刷新所有微服务实例的配置 Sleuth+zipkin(

62720
领券